Kaurgutta - Usur, Bijapur

Kaurgutta is a village situated in the Usur tehsil of Bijapur district, Chhattisgarh. It is located approximately 100 km from the tehsil headquarters in Usur and around 120 km from the district headquarters in Bijapur. Kanchal serves as the Gram Panchayat for Kaurgutta village.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Kaurgutta is 450950. The village covers a total geographical area of 50.43 hectares and falls under the 494447 pincode. Bhadrachalam (a.p.) is the nearest town, located about 103 km away.

Kaurgutta village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Bijapur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Bastar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.

Population of Kaurgutta

As per Census 2011, Kaurgutta village has a total population of 422 people, consisting of 193 males and 229 females. The village has 97 households and a sex ratio of 1,186 females per 1,000 males. There are 127 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 15 literate and 407 illiterate residents. Additionally, 422 people belong to Scheduled Tribe (ST) communities.
